Kamdhenu Limited has received formal confirmation from Kamdhenu Ventures Limited regarding the successful allotment of 2,96,45,000 warrants on March 21, 2026. This follows the earlier payment of Rs 5.04 crore as the mandatory 25% upfront payment made on March 20, 2026. The warrant allotment represents a significant inter-group investment transaction within the Kamdhenu Group.

Warrant Allotment Confirmation and Structure

The warrant allotment was executed at an issue price of Rs 6.80 per warrant, including a premium of Rs 5.80 each over the face value of Re 1 per equity share. The warrants are convertible into equivalent equity shares within the stipulated timeframe as per SEBI regulations.

Kamdhenu Limited delivered exceptional profitability in Q3FY26, with net profit after tax surging 67% year-on-year to ₹20.8 crore despite a marginal revenue decline. The TMT bar manufacturer achieved record profit before tax margins of 15.9%, expanding by 620 basis points, driven by strong franchise performance and operational efficiency improvements.

Outstanding Q3FY26 Financial Performance

The company's quarterly results for the period ended December 31, 2025, demonstrated remarkable profit growth despite revenue headwinds. Key financial highlights include:

Metric: Q3FY26 Q3FY25 Change (%)
Revenue from Operations: ₹168.8 crore ₹175.0 crore -3%
Profit Before Tax: ₹26.8 crore ₹16.9 crore +58%
Net Profit After Tax: ₹20.8 crore ₹12.5 crore +67%
PBT Margin: 15.9% 9.7% +620 bps

The significant improvement in profitability was achieved despite a 3% decline in revenue, primarily attributed to metal price fluctuations and implementation of GRAP Stage III and IV measures in the NCR region affecting own facility volumes.

Franchise Business Drives Growth

The company's asset-light franchise model continued to deliver strong results, with franchise volumes growing 18% year-on-year to 9.7 lakh MT in Q3FY26. This growth translated into record royalty income performance:

Business Segment: Q3FY26 Q3FY25 Change (%)
Revenue from Own Facilities: ₹125.6 crore ₹141.4 crore -11%
Volume from Own Facilities: 28.1 thousand MT 28.3 thousand MT -1%
Revenue from Royalty Income: ₹43.0 crore ₹33.4 crore +29%
Franchise Volumes: 9.7 lakh MT 8.3 lakh MT +18%

For the nine-month period, franchise volumes increased 11% to 27.7 lakh MT, while royalty income grew 28% to ₹128.9 crore, reflecting deeper brand penetration and improved partner throughput.

Management Commentary on Performance

Chairman & Managing Director Satish Kumar Agarwal highlighted the company's ability to deliver strong profitability despite TMT bar price volatility. He emphasized that royalty income remains a highly capital-efficient and RoCE accretive business, allowing scalability without incremental manufacturing investments. The management noted that own manufacturing facilities are operating at near peak utilization, making the asset-light franchise route the strategic priority for expansion.

Strategic Focus and Outlook

The company continues to evaluate investments in selective franchise partners to increase capacities where demand visibility is strong and regional presence can be strengthened. With expected revival in government and private capex and continued policy thrust on infrastructure, management remains confident of maintaining strong demand momentum in the TMT bar segment while delivering consistent, profitable growth.
